Family Practice Nurse/Nursing (Master’s)

Westminster conferred 28 master’s completions in family practice nurse/nursing in the most recent reporting year — 82% to women and 18% to men. The most common background among these graduates was White (64%).

Nurse Anesthetist (Master’s)

Westminster awarded 24 master’s completions in nurse anesthetist in the most recent reporting year — 46% to women and 54% to men. Most of these graduates identified as White (92%).
